Outdoor Tents Stove Safety And Security Tips
Outdoor tents stoves can be a practical means to cook in the comfort of your camping tent, yet only when they're utilized securely. Correct use of a tent oven decreases the threat of carbon monoxide gas poisoning and fire risk.

To reduce these threats, remember the following camping tent stove security pointers:

Ensure Your Outdoor Tents Is Fire-Resistant
Tents are made from flammable material and must be kept at least a number of feet away from open cooktops. They ought to likewise be placed upwind and far from any ground debris that might conveniently catch fire.

Make certain that your tent is created to suit a range, and constantly make use of a flame-resistant range mat. This produces a barrier in between the warm stove and the floor of your camping tent, dramatically reducing the threat of fire.

Avoid storing highly combustible things inside your tent, consisting of insect repellent, butane cans, and cooking oils. Also, keep your water storage tank a risk-free range from the cooktop to stop it from falling on you and creating severe, uncomfortable first level burns. Finally, make sure to cleanse your trigger arrestor regularly to reduce creosote buildup.

Maintain a Fire Extinguisher on Hand
Outdoor tents ranges can provide a great deal of benefit and convenience when camping. However, they likewise pose some threats if not utilized correctly. These consist of carbon monoxide poisoning, smoke breathing, and fires. To reduce these hazards, constantly follow skilled tent cooktop security pointers like appropriate ventilation, cleaning, and understanding of early warning signs of threat.

Maintain a multipurpose completely dry chemical fire extinguisher available. This is the best kind of extinguisher for outdoor tents ranges as it can produce both flammable and flammable materials. Additionally, make sure you utilize it correctly by intending the nozzle low in the direction of the base of the cooktop from a risk-free range away and squeezing the operating bar.

Lastly, you must constantly clean your spark arrestor on a regular basis. Clogged stimulate arrestors can create smoke to leave your stove door and might bring about a range pipeline fire.
